Thermal conductivity is the most important thermophysical material parameter that describes the heat transfer characteristics of a material or component.The thermal conductivity meter reflects important information about material composition, purity and structure, as well as secondary performance characteristics such as thermal shock tolerance.

Thermal Conductivity Segment by Type

- Heat Wire Method

- Light Flash Method

- Heat Flow Method
